  1. The Tinkers "Find"
    The public house in "The Battery" it seems did an illicit trade in "poteen." Excise men and police men on its track always.
    This time, in order to keep out of the "jaws of the law" the wory publican buried a large jar of 'poteen' in the wood until such time as it would be required for immiediate consumption. Meanwhile, a band of tinkers on their usual peregrinations fixed their temporary abode in the wood. Gathering firewood one day they struck on the buried poteen. They took it with them to their 'abode.' Tinker after tinker imbibed copious draughts. Each went his way, but not for long. One fell here, another fell there, a third, a fourth, and so on. All fell fast asleep, and remained asleep for three or four days without ever opening an eye.
    One, more fortunate that the rest, fell in a shallow dyke of water. As it was winter and frost abroad the poor fellow had actually to be picked out of the ice with picks. He was one solid mass of pains for his life afterwords.
